Rebel Carbon

Carbon fibre mountainbike frame

Storck Bicycle GmbH

After the success of the Scenario and Adrenalin carbon fibre frames a new sibling in the mountainbike family was to be expected. Top at the list of priorities: to develop a super light yet rigid frame. The proven form of the classic Rebel mountainbike frame has been adapted to the material characteristics of carbon fibre. The futuristic new 3-D dropouts provide a strong mounting point for shifting components, disc brake and rear wheel as well as unusual and innovative design. The result is not just beautiful to behold: in first tests the frame received top marks in stiffness and STW (Stiffness-to-Weight) categories.
